Switzerland traders comparing InvestoPro vs Dukascopy in 2025 face a clear choice between cost efficiency and local regulation. InvestoPro, with a higher score of 3.8/5, appeals to retail traders seeking low spreads and modern deposit methods like USDT TRC20. Dukascopy, scoring 3.3/5, is a Swiss-based broker regulated by FINMA, offering familiarity and trust for local clients. Both brokers accept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20, making deposits convenient for Swiss residents. However, their trading costs, platform features, and regulatory oversight differ significantly. This comparison helps Switzerland traders decide based on their specific needs, whether prioritizing low costs or local regulatory protection.

Switzerland traders will find InvestoPro’s platform modern and user-friendly, with MetaTrader 4/5 and a proprietary web trader. Dukascopy offers its JForex platform, which is powerful but has a steeper learning curve. For retail traders in Switzerland, InvestoPro’s intuitive interface and mobile app are more accessible. Dukascopy’s platform includes advanced charting and algorithmic trading tools, suited for experienced traders. Both platforms support Swiss Franc accounts and local time zones.

Regulation is critical for Switzerland traders. Dukascopy is regulated by FINMA, Switzerland’s top financial regulator, providing deposit protection and strict oversight. InvestoPro is regulated by the local financial regulator, ensuring compliance with Swiss laws but potentially less stringent than FINMA. For traders prioritizing maximum security, Dukascopy’s FINMA regulation offers peace of mind. However, InvestoPro’s local regulation still meets Swiss standards, making both legally sound for Swiss residents.

Switzerland traders can deposit and withdraw using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20 at both brokers. InvestoPro processes e-wallet deposits instantly, while bank transfers take 1-3 business days. USDT TRC20 deposits are credited within minutes. Dukascopy supports the same methods but may have higher minimums for crypto deposits (e.g., $50 for USDT TRC20). Withdrawals at InvestoPro are free for e-wallets, while Dukascopy charges a small fee for bank transfers. Both brokers accept CHF and USD, making it easy for Swiss clients to manage funds.

Both InvestoPro and Dukascopy off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Switzerland traders. These accounts eliminate overnight interest charges, complying with Sharia law. InvestoPro provides Islamic accounts on all account types with no restrictions on trading instruments. Dukascopy offers Islamic accounts but may limit some currency pairs and CFDs. Switzerland Muslim traders should check with both brokers for specific terms, as Dukascopy’s conditions are more restrictive.
